Th. Deng et al., Solubility of anthracene in ternary (propanol plus heptane plus cyclohexane) and (butanol plus heptane plus cyclohexane) solvent mixtures, J CHEM THER, 31(2), 1999, pp. 205-210
Experimental solubilities are reported for anthracene dissolved in ternary
(1-propanol + heptane + cyclohexane), (2-propanol + heptane + cyclohexane),
(1-butanol + heptane + cyclohexane), and (2-butanol + heptane + cyclohexan
e) solvent mixtures at T = 298.15 K. Nineteen compositions were studied for
each of the four solvent systems. Results of these measurements are used t
o test the predictive ability of the ternary solvent form of the combined N
IBS/Redlich-Kister equation. Computations showed that the model predicted t
he observed solubility behavior to within an overall average absolute devia
tion of about 1.3 per cent. (C) 1999 Academic Press.
